Understanding Smoking Aids

Explore the Benefits of Smoking Aids and Electronic Cigarettes for Quitting

Smoking aids are tools or products designed to help individuals quit smoking by easing the transition away from traditional cigarettes. They come in various forms, such as nicotine patches, gum, lozenges, inhalers, and nasal sprays. Each of these aids delivers a controlled dose of nicotine to the user, reducing cravings and withdrawal symptoms without the need to smoke.

  • Nicotine Patches: Worn on the skin, they release nicotine steadily, allowing for a constant level in the bloodstream.

  • Nicotine Gum: Chewing the gum helps reduce immediate cravings by quickly providing a burst of nicotine.
  • Nicotine Lozenges: These dissolve in the mouth, offering a controlled release of nicotine to curb the urge to smoke.

The effectiveness of these aids often depends on the smoker’s level of dependence and their commitment to quitting. Combining these aids with behavioral therapies significantly increases the success rate of quitting smoking.

Electronic Cigarettes: The Modern Solution

Electronic cigarettes, commonly referred to as e-cigarettes, have surged in popularity as a smoking cessation tool. Unlike traditional cigarettes, e-cigarettes vaporize a liquid containing nicotine, allowing users to inhale vapor instead of smoke.

Many ex-smokers find e-cigarettes beneficial because they mimic the physical action of smoking, thereby addressing both the nicotine addiction and the habitual aspects of smoking.

“E-cigarettes provide a less harmful alternative by eliminating tar and other harmful substances found in regular cigarettes.”

Moreover, users appreciate the ability to customize their vaping experience with a wide range of flavors and nicotine levels. This customization helps in gradually decreasing nicotine dependence until the user reaches a nicotine-free state.

The Science Behind Nicotine Replacement

Nicotine replacement therapy (NRT) is fundamental in smoking cessation. Both smoking aids and electronic cigarettes serve this purpose by substituting the nicotine derived from cigarettes without the harmful byproducts of combustion.

Studies indicate that smokers who use NRT are twice as likely to succeed in quitting compared to those who use no assistance. The role of NRT is to stabilize nicotine levels, making it easier for the body to adjust to the absence of cigarettes and eventually eliminate nicotine use altogether.

Common Questions About Smoking Aids and E-Cigarettes

Are e-cigarettes safer than traditional cigarettes?

Yes, e-cigarettes are considered safer because they do not involve burning, which creates most harmful toxins found in traditional smoking.

Can I use more than one smoking aid at a time?

Combining smoking aids can be effective under professional guidance. Consulting with a healthcare provider ensures a safe approach tailored to your needs.

How long should I use smoking aids or e-cigarettes?

The duration varies depending on individual needs. It’s generally recommended to use them until you’re confident you can stay smoke-free without assistance.
